When I start to feel frustrated that there’s just nothing left to photograph without getting on the train or in the car (and let’s face it, that would require actually leaving the house! who has time for that?), I like to play a game that I call 50 steps, in which I challenge myself to take 5 solid photographs while taking only 50 steps. This forces me to look at what I see every single day with a new eye. Yesterday, I planted my feet firmly on the front porch and began.
